A recent article in The Times talks about current and near-future battlefield technologies:
FORGET the Terminator. The killer robot of the 21st century will be the illegitimate child of a vacuum cleaner and a John Deere tractor. It does not wear sunglasses. And it is as likely to save your life as blow your brains out.
Meet the R-Gator, an unmanned, six-wheeled vehicle that can be programmed to follow soldiers around the battlefield like a mechanical pooch, using laser guidance to avoid obstacles. It can also perform unmanned patrols, carry soldiers’ backpacks and be upgraded to dispose of unexploded bombs.
Plans for the R-Gator were unveiled this week at a military engineering conference in Orlando, Florida, along with blueprints and prototypes of several other next-generation battlefield robots.
